Jane Hunter 1769–1855 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 1769

Birth Location: Tundergarth, dumfrs

Death Date: 1855

Death Location: Ecclefechan, Dumfries and Galloway, Scotland

Father: Thomas Johnson

Mother: Jamima Paxton

Spouse(s): Herbert Hunter

Children(s): John Hunter, Thomas Hunter

Jane Hunter was born in 1769 in Tundergarth, dumfrs, the child of Thomas Johnson And Jamima Paxton. Jane Hunter married Herbert Hunter, and had children including John Hunter, Thomas Hunter. Jane Hunter passed away in 1855 in Ecclefechan, Dumfries and Galloway, Scotland.
